**Ticket PARITY-412: Kestrel SDK catch-up**

Quick one for the weekly sync: the Kestrel-Go SDK is still missing batched uploads and retry hints that Kestrel-JS shipped two releases ago. Partner teams keep asking. Plan is to land both behind a flag this sprint and cut a minor release. Needs a sign-off from the owner named below.

account owner for bajef-badup: Drueth Kelath Pelael Holwyn

## Summary

This PR reworks the read-window logic in ChipHerald, our marathon timing-chip reader, ahead of the Fennwick Valley race. Previously we accepted any tag read within a fixed five-second window, which double-counted runners who lingered on the mats. The new approach uses a per-runner cooldown plus a signal-strength floor, both tunable. I ran it against last season's replay logs from the Darrow Bridge split and dupes dropped by roughly 90% with no missed finishers. Please sanity-check the defaults before the sync. They are listed here.

tuning constants:
TIERS = {
    "pelwyn": 241,
    "praeth": 713,
    "quenys": 929,
}

Ticket: LEDGERPIPE-88 — The integration suite for the Tollgate payments service fails intermittently at the signature-check stage. Root cause: the test harness signs fixture payloads with a rotating ephemeral key, but two of the flaky tests cache a stale verifier from a previous run. Fix in this PR pins the verifier to the harness key and adds a teardown that clears the cache. Reviewer note: the retry wrapper was removed, so failures are now deterministic. Verification in CI requires the current signing key, shown here.

release key, fahaf-bajof: bky3_Xam

The Quillhaven admin dashboard exposes dark-mode tokens through the `theme-bridge` API. Plugins must read palette values at render time rather than hardcoding hex codes; the bridge re-emits a `themechange` event whenever an operator toggles modes. Test both palettes using the sandbox runner bundled with the SDK, which mirrors the production token set. The sandbox authenticates against the Quillhaven plugin registry to fetch the canonical theme manifest, so before launching it, add the following line to your local environment file:

sealed setting: ARCHIVE_KEY3=8d0